''Bank of America, Citigroup, JPMorgan Chase Face Billions In Losses in Antitrust Case''

From 4closureFraud

''Private antitrust litigation pitting some five million retailers against Visa , MasterCard , and 13 large banks, including Bank of America and Citigroup has slipped under the radar of many analysts and investors who follow those companies, but the case may deliver a multi-billion dollar shock to bank bulls in the coming months.

Aside from Bank of America and Citigroup, the other banks that appear to have the most at stake as a result of the litigation in the U.S. Eastern District of New York are US Bancorp and JPMorgan Chase. All four face billions in potential losses.''
